Summary: Retry index rebuild if time stamp of index changes while
rebuilding

We currently base our decision to retry the index rebuild on the
INDEX_DISABLE_TIMESTAMP changing. This works fine when we disable the index on
a write failure, because the transition from DISABLE -> INACTIVE will fail and
we'll try the rebuild again later. However, this is not the case when the index
is left ACTIVE. As an additional safeguard, we should fail the rebuild and
retry again in the next polling.
